Caz awoke to the sound of gunfire. For a moment, he thought he'd left his video game on, but after shaking the sleep out of his eyes, he realized the sound was coming from outside. Instantly transforming into Cazmonster, he ran to the 7th floor window of his dorm room.
Outside, just up the street, a line of very nervous looking campus police was trying to get organized. Further up the street was a well armed force that seemed to have phenominal aim and reaction speeds, firing some sort of automatic weapons.
Turning on his internal phone, Cazmonster dialed the rest of the Infinite Seven. "This is Cazmonster! Looks like they're bringing the violence right to us again! There's an army outside Langley. Get there as quick as possible!" With that, the cyber-wolf lept from the window, covering the distance to the police line with a single jump.
"Gentlement! Maybe I can be of assistance! I'm..." suddenly a bullet struck him in the shoulder. Wait a minute, thought Cazmonster. That HURT. Looking over at his arm, he noticed he was bleeding. These were no ordinary guns. And those were no ordinary troops!
Cazmonster pursed his lips in anger and furrowed his wolfy brow. Picking up a nearby compact car, he launched it through the air into the army, knocking down several of the invading troops. He was astonished when one of them lifted the remains of the car off his fellow soldiers. Cazmonster couldn't believe it, but he'd swear the armored troops were Nexers!
From behind the line, a flash of pink and orange flew past Cazmonster faster than he could see, and in an instant, Triumph stood before him, having disarmed several of the troops. Dropping the pile, he ran back into the fray. The American Attitude bounced off a nearby squadcar on his skateboard, and distributed the advanced rifles to the police.
"These are gonna do a lot more good than those pea shooters you're using," he said, refering to the nine-mil pistols the police had.
"What about you?" one of the officers, a heavy-set woman with curly red hair asked him as she took aim with the new rifle.
"Not my style," The Attitude said simply.
The Attitude turned back to Cazmonster who, amid the violence, was looking for something heavier to throw.
"Hey, CM. Nice of you to join us!"
"Join you?" Cazmonster asked. Settling on a massive air conditioning unit, Cazmonster ripped the object from it's concrete moorings and launched it into the air. It landed close, but unfortunately for the defending police, there were now invading Nexer troops at close range. A few of them didn't get back up.
"Yeah, we've been fighting these guys for about an half-hour. It took them fifteen minutes to take out most of the Stevenson police force. We rendezvous'd here hoping to regroup with reinforcements."
"Sorry, didn't know," Cazmonster said, leaping now into melee with a dozen or so Nexers. They quickly began flying every direction, including straight into the pavement.
"Yeah, well, you would have if you'd let us join!" The Attitude said, leaping into action. He was good, Cazmonster could tell. Not as good as Dragonfly, but he certainly made original use of the staff and skateboard that were his trademark. He managed to down two of the Nexers, but Cazmonster could tell his stamina was beginning to wear down.
From out of the sky, a dark form flew directly overhead, strafing several of the approaching troops with high-speed metal spikes. Palisade was here!
"Hey, Cazmonster, giving the newbees some lessons?" he asked. As he doubled back and landed near the police barricade, several of the spikes he fired began spewing some type of gas. Soon, several Nexers fell to the ground gagging. Palisade popped one in the helmet, breaking the glass and the nose underneath, and that Nexer fell as well.
"Lay off the newbees, er, new guys. They've been holding down the fort waiting for us!" Cazmonster downed several more, but they just kept coming. Since the heroes had arrived, however, no more police had been shot.
Triumph came running back behind the lines and slowed to a halt, where he promptly fell and skidded several feet. Cazmonster hadn't seen him long enough earlier to notice he'd been shot at least once, and was badly bruised. Just then, several bullets nailed Palisade and sent him flying through the air.
As Cazmonster watched, wondering if he could somehow catch Palisade, a huge plot of earth flew into the air and did the job for him, carefully depositing him on the ground in front of Langley. The Gray Robe had joined the party, and that probably meant...The Adept!
Cazmonster turned to face the invaders and watched as the street opened up beneath them, swallowing a dozen or so. "Cazmonster, thanks for the call. Is that Triumph?" The Adept asked, pointing to the wounded hero.
"Yeah, he and The American Attitude are here!" The Attitude landed blow after blow with his staff and skateboard as Cazmonster continued wading outward.
"Does anyone know what the hell's going on here?" The Gray Robe asked, hovering over the battle and launching clods of earth at her opponents.
"Not really," The Attitude snapped. "Cops are dead; lots of cops. No idea who these guys are or what their plan is."
"I wish Dragonfly was here," The Adept said. "He was the expert on this Nex stuff."
"Yeah, we all do," Palisade said; already the bullet holes had healed over, and Palisade looked as good as new. "But I'll settle for her!" From a side road walked a figure cloaked in darkness, a young woman all in black, with pale skin and brown hair.
"Angela! I think that's everyone, well the new everyone," The Adept corrected.
The new team was fighting the invading, and quite well armed and organized, Nexers successfully. The Adept wielded mystic portals and magical energy blasts, both quite effective against their current opponents. Cazmonster threw around dozens of them like rag dolls every few seconds, and shrugged off their bullets despite the large number of minor injuries he was taking. The American Attitude, longest in this battle, fought on, despite exhaustion. Palisade took to the skies, and between he and the Gray Robe, provided an air advantage. Angela the vampire did what vampires do best, and she did it viscously. Triumph even managed to get a second wind, and began punching Nexers at high speed.
The battle lasted another 15 minutes before the National Guard, or what was left of them after a pre-emptive strike by the Nexer army, arrived from behind to reinforce the police. By the end of it, everyone in the Infinite Seven was bruised and bloodied: Cazmonster had been shot several times, Triumph once (though his wounds were already healing), and Angela a few times as well. The bullets pierced her, but they seemed not to impede her as they would the living. Palisade had managed to mostly shield the Gray Robe, though she'd been graze once across her cheek and was bleeding heavily. The Adept had been caught unawares by a Nexer who'd crossed the lines toward the end of the battle, and knocked unconscious.
By the time the invading army had surrendered, many of them were either passing out or having cardiac events due to the amount of Nex in their systems. None of them seemed to remember, when asked, how they'd gotten the weapons, or why they started the battle.
"This does not bode well," The Adept said once the heroes had gathered at their HQ later that night. The American Attitude and Triumph had been allowed into the HQ with the provision that they enter through one of The Adept's portals so they didn't know where the HQ was or how to get there.
"Sure as hell doesn't! There are dozens of cops dead, and we're wasted! We need to help with regular street crime until the police can get some recruits," Attitude said, leaning back in Dragonfly's chair.
"Not a bad idea, but not what I meant," The Adept said. "The Nex pushers all but moved out of town. We haven't fought Nexers in quite a while, with the exception of a few Angela handled over the break. Why would they come back HERE, in force, and organized?"
No one was able to answer the question. "It's a good bet we're not the only target," the Attitude said ominously. "Imagine an army ten times this size marching down State Street in Chicago."
"We need to keep our eyes open, and put all our resources toward figuring this out," Adept concluded.
"As such, if there are no objections, welcome to the Infinite Seven, gentlemen!" The Adept held out his hand to the Attitude, who hesitated, but then took it and shook it solidly.
